Facilitated diffusion or passive transport involves a substance diffusing down a concentration gradient across a membrane without requiring the cell to expend any energy.

A concentration gradient is simply a region of space where the concentration of a substance changes, and substances will naturally move down gradients, from a higher concentration area to a lower concentration area.

Some molecules, such as carbon dioxide and oxygen, can diffuse directly across the plasma membrane, but others require assistance to cross its hydrophobic core. Molecular diffusion occurs when molecules diffuse across the plasma membrane with the help of membrane proteins such as channels and carriers.

Polycomb group proteins are a group of gene-regulating proteins that have been conserved in evolution and play important roles in development and cell differentiation.

They are essential for the maintenance of gene repression. The role of Polycomb group proteins in maintaining gene repression is as follows:

Polycomb group proteins control the transcriptional activity of genes by regulating chromatin structure, which is crucial for gene expression. They do this by modifying the histones that make up the nucleosomes in chromatin, which in turn affects the accessibility of the DNA to the transcriptional machinery.

In particular, the Polycomb group proteins catalyze the methylation of histone H3 on lysine 27, which leads to the recruitment of other repressive proteins that maintain the chromatin in a compact, inactive state.In addition, Polycomb group proteins also function in higher-order chromatin organization. They help to organize chromatin into higher-order structures, such as loops and domains, which can have important effects on gene expression.

This is achieved through the recruitment of other proteins, such as insulator proteins, which help to establish boundaries between different chromatin domains. In summary, Polycomb group proteins are critical for the maintenance of gene repression by regulating chromatin structure and higher-order chromatin organization.

What is the difference between dark field microscopy and bright field microscopy?

Answers

The difference between dark field microscopy and bright field microscopy is that field view of dark field is dark while bright field microscopy have bright background.

Dark field microscopy has a dark background against which bright image is formed. It is used in observing the live specimen and it only shows the external features of the specimen.

Light field microscopy on the other hand have a white background against which a dark image is formed. It is usually used for the observation of fixed specimen that are stained using various dyes. It shows external as well as internal details.

Fatty acids are straight chain carbon compounds of varying lengths. It is an important component of lipid in plant and animals. All fats are known to contain nine calories per gram, therefore can add to the weight of an individual. There are two type of fatty acids which includes:

--> Saturated fatty acids: these are fatty acids that contains no double bonds making it solid at room temperature. They are usually found in animal products such as milk, cheese and meat. They are absorbed in the villi of small intestine after digestion. One of the disadvantages of consuming diet rich in saturated fat is Saturated fats might increase LDL cholesterol levels. These are the bad cholesterol which are affected by inhibiting the LDL receptor activities leading to its increase. This can lead to heart disease conditions.

--> Unsaturated fatty acids: These are fatty acids which may contain one or more double bonds making it liquid at room temperature. They are found in plant oil (omega 6) and fish oil (omega 3). When consumed, they are absorbed in the villi of small intestine and helps maintain a good balance of cholesterol in blood.
